Embedded Systems Expert at Extreme Networks focusing on platform design and development with Linux components. Collaborating in multi-site teams and supporting the networking products development.
Responsibilities
We are looking for an embedded systems expert doing platform system design and development with essential knowledge of the underlying hardware on any of the new generation networking products of Extreme Networks.
This would involve integrating PHY drivers from multiple vendors, identifying and integrating OS changes/upgrades necessary and working on Linux networking components as well.
Work can also be in platform framework with systems with virtual machine support using hypervisors or having Kubernetes based docker/microservices supported.
Exposure to working on open-source components is a part of this role.
This role requires knowledge of the industry trends.
As an individual contributor, one should be a team player and should work in a multi-site mode along with other teams in different time zones as well.
Requirements
BE/B.Tech or ME/MTech preferably in the field of Electronics & communications or Computer Science.
Work experience of 8 to 14 years in the following areas:
Good understanding of switch/router H/W and S/W arch and knowledge of networking domain.
Experience in platform infrastructure & embedded software device driver development in switches/ routers.
Familiar with – Broadcom MACs and PHYs and Barefoot components and their SDKs
Familiar with Baseboard management Controller(BMC), IPMI.
Familiar with Ethernet ports and optics with speeds up to 400G/800G, breakout capabilities, auto-negotiation, FEC.
Experience in working with linux networking components; using ONL/ONLP, IPMI, etc is essential.
Worked on Linux device driver for various devices and interfaces - FPGA/CPLD, I2C, SPI, MMC/SD, PCI, USB, SATA and be familiar with DMA and interrupts in Linux
Linux build infra and tools including exposure to Linux embedded boot environment - uboot, ONIE, UEFI/BIOS would be helpful.
Debugging skills - using GDB, Kernel and drivers level debugging and application level debugging.
Experience in VMs and Dockers with microservices architecture would help.
Programming in C, C++ and scripting language (shell script and python).
Source version control tool and environment - GIT and Jenkins.
Project Engineer at Nestlé Purina supervising construction and installation works in Nowa Wieś Wrocławska. Ensuring compliance with quality and safety standards in the food industry.
Maintenance Engineer responsible for delivering planned maintenance at Yara's Pocklington site. Supporting production continuity and contributing to overall equipment effectiveness improvements.
Continuous Improvement Engineer at SQA Services enhancing efficiency through implementing improvement initiatives and overseeing quality functions. Significant role in analyzing processes and optimizing workflows.
Launch Structures Engineer at Aerospace Corporation assessing launch vehicle hardware and contributing to mission success. Collaborating with teams for structural integrity of next - gen space solutions.
RPO Flight Dynamics Engineer providing analysis and technical solutions for the aerospace sector. Involves collaboration on space system design, research, and flight dynamics tools.
Electronics Parts, Materials, and Processes Engineer supporting advanced semiconductor packaging for aerospace systems. Leading PM&P program management and collaboration with industry partners.
Senior Guidance and Control Engineer at Draper developing software for cutting - edge space and defense systems. Joining multidisciplinary teams to tackle national challenges.
Fiber Documentation Engineer responsible for designing, documenting, and optimizing fiber networks for xAI's infrastructure. Field - intensive role requiring travel and collaboration in dynamic environments.
Requirement Engineer analyzing and specifying features of Delegate's software solutions. Collaborating with international teams to ensure technical feasibility and clear documentation.